Frigivelse af applikationsudviklingsmiljø KDevelop 5.5

Efter seks måneders udvikling præsenteret frigivelse af det integrerede programmeringsmiljø KDevelop 5.5, som fuldt ud understøtter udviklingsprocessen for KDE 5, inklusive brug af Clang som en compiler. Projektkoden distribueres under GPL-licensen og bruger KDE Frameworks 5 og Qt 5 bibliotekerne.

Frigivelse af applikationsudviklingsmiljø KDevelop 5.5

Den nye version mangler væsentlige innovationer - hovedarbejdet var fokuseret på at øge stabiliteten, optimere ydeevnen og forenkle vedligeholdelsen af ​​kodebasen. Blandt ændringerne:

  • Forbedret C++ sprogunderstøttelse. Tilføjet manglende advarsler om at inkludere tilgængelige header-filer som standard. Plugins til kodeanalyse baseret på Clang-tidy og Clazy tilføjet muligheden for at vælge sæt checks. Typesøgningslogikken for proaktiv kodefuldførelse er blevet udvidet;
  • Forbedret PHP sprogunderstøttelse: tilføjet understøttelse af indtastede egenskaber introduceret i PHP 7.4, import af funktioner og konstanter fra andre navneområder, rækker af typer и synlige klassekonstanter;
  • Tilføjet indledende support Python 3.8;
  • Implementeret et separat område til visning af advarsler og meddelelser under applikationsstart uden at vise blokerende dialogbokse;
  • Tilføjet en dialog for at udføre rebase-operationen i Git;
  • Giver gentagelig opbygning af tjærearkiver, implementeret gennem installation af Pax-headere;
  • Tilføjet understøttelse til at overføre miljøvariabler fra procesmiljøet og muligheden for at konfigurere et flatpak-baseret miljø;
  • En mulighed er blevet tilføjet til indstillingerne for at deaktivere fanelukningsknapper.

Kilde: opennet.ru

Tilføj en kommentar